Prepare to be entertained by the one and only Michael Bubl . The Canadian Academy of Recording Arts and Sciences (CARAS) and CBC today announced that the 12-time JUNO Award winner and beloved Canadian crooner is set to host The 2018 JUNO Awards, which will be held at the Rogers Arena in Vancouver on Sunday, March 25, 2018 and broadcast live across Canada on CBC and CBC Radio and around the world on CBCMusic.ca at 5 p.m. PT/8 p.m. ET (6 p.m. MT, 7 p.m. CT, 9 p.m. AT, 9:30 p.m. NT).

Today, the National Civil Rights Museum announced recipients of The Freedom Award, the museum's signature event that honors outstanding individuals for their significant contributions to civil and human rights. This year's honorees are Benjamin Crump, civil rights attorney; Tawakkol Karman, Yemeni human rights activist and Nobel Peace Prize Laureate; The Honorable Damon Jerome Keith, longest serving judge on the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Sixth Circuit Court; Soledad O'Brien, journalist and executive producer; and Bryan Stevenson, attorney and social justice activist.
Woodie King Jr.'s New Federal Theatre (NFT) held a festive Gala Benefit on Sunday, June 26 from 2:00 to 5:30 PM at Trump Place, 220 Riverside Boulevard (enter West 70th Street) honoring Novella Nelson and Melvin Van Peebles, two of many actors and directors who have worked at NFT over the theatre's 46 year history. Mr. Van Peebles was introduced by Academy Award winner Estelle Parsons. Ms. Nelson was introduced by former Mayor David Dinkins. Scroll down for photos from the event!

GREASE is the word at York Little Theatre (YLT) September 19-21, 26-28 and October 3-5. YLT'S GREASE is ready to rock its way onto the main stage to start the theatre's 82nd season with a cast and crew of over 35, a two story set with a full size Greased Lightning car, special permission and rights to add the movie songs that are not normally performed in the stage version, and heart thumping choreography. Get ready to hand jive and rock in your seats with favorites including GREASE IS THE WORD, WE GO TOGETHER, HOPELESSLY DEVOTED TO YOU, and YOU'RE THE ONE THAT I WANT to name a few. Jordan Smith-Kingston, the reigning York County Distinguished Young Woman, portrays the wholesome Sandy Dumbrowski and Patrick Douglas is the rebellious Danny Zuko.

York Little Theatre will give a new meaning to "going green" as they present the musical comedy SHREK the Musical, July 18-20 and 24-27. The musical will transport audiences to a faraway kingdom that is turned upside down. Things get ugly when an unseemly ogre -not a handsome prince- shows up to rescue a feisty princess. Add a donkey who won't shut up, a bad guy with a SHORT temper, a cookie with an attitude and over a dozen other fairy tale misfits, and the result is a big mess that calls for a real hero. Luckily, there's one on hand...and his name is Shrek. Based on the Oscar winning DreamWorks film that started it all, SHREK the Musical brings the hilarious story of everyone's favorite ogre to life on stage, teaching the lesson : being different is what makes us special.
The Delaware Art Museum is under fire for auctioning William Holman Hunt's Isabella and the Pot of Basil for a fraction of what was hoped. The sale at Christie's brought in a mere $4.9 million when it was valued to sell for $8.4 million to $13.4 million.
